The largest collections prioritize uncompressed formats (WAV/AIFF) over lossy compression (MP3). A single song in a multitrack format can consume 500MB to 2GB of storage. A collection of 1,000 songs, therefore, requires terabytes of server space, distinguishing these archives from standard streaming libraries.
